Information
from the Tri-City News & BBC News
Simple slip and stumbles cost
the region more than $6 million a year in hospital care alone, plus
home nursing and therapies.
In the year 2000, 604 people
were hospitalized for fractured hips for an average of 13.8 days
each.
Elderly people are most at
risk of hurting themselves on stairs and more than 100,000 are treated
for injuries every year. Of these, more than half end up in the
hospital with serious injuries.
Stairs are the place where
most deaths and serious injuries happen in the home.
It is a tragedy that a simple
fall down stairs can take the lives of over 1,000 people every year
and seriously injure thousands of others.
More falling deaths result
from stairs and steps, according to the Consumer Product Safety
Commission.
